#734490 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#734490 is composed of 45.1% red, 26.7% green and 56.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 20.1% cyan, 52.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.5% black. It has a hue angle of 277.1 degrees, a saturation of 35.8% and a lightness of 41.6%. #734490 color hex could be obtained by blending #e688ff with #000021.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#734490

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#09050b is the darkest color, while #fdfc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#734490

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6b656f is the less saturated color, while #8203d1 is the most saturated one.
